WOOD BOARDS MANUFACTURING METHOD Russian patent published in 2025 - IPC B27N3/04 

Abstract RU 2840423 C1

FIELD: performing operations.

SUBSTANCE: invention relates to production of wood boards. Wood raw material is placed in a container with water, subjected to cavitation treatment in a hydrodynamic disperser with subsequent hot pressing. Wood raw material used is tumbled wood which is first crushed and sieved to obtain a fine fraction. After treatment fine particles are mixed with water with temperature not less than 30 °C in weight ratio from 6 to 12 and from 94 to 88 wt.pts. respectively. Obtained pulp is passed in cascades through 4 or 5 dispersers. Obtained wood pulp is pumped by a pump into a container, from where it is metered to a casting device, where the moisture content of the mass is reduced to 170-250%, after which the resulting carpet is pressed on a mesh pallet in a hot flat press at temperature of 180 °C and specific pressure from 3.0 MPa with specific duration of pressing in range from 0.8 to 1.5 min/mm.

EFFECT: improved physical and mechanical properties of wood boards, reduced power consumption.
